The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of George Smith, born in 1839 in Lee, Kent, consisted of 7 members. George was the head of the household, married to Elizabeth Smith, born in 1842 in Bristol, Gloucestershire, England. They had 5 children; George (born 1864 in St Pancras, Middlesex, England), James (born 1867 in Islington, Middlesex, England), Joseph (born 1871 in Islington, Middlesex, England), Elizabeth (born 1875 in Islington, Middlesex, England) and Ann (born 1878 in St Pancras, Middlesex, England).
